Your task is to find something you can do for someone else to pass on a little kindness. I am not putting any parameters on what you can or can’t do, except that you cannot do something that benefits yourself, like clean your room. I mean come on, some of your mom’s would probably faint if you cleaned your room, but it’s your room; that does not count. So pay it forward for a friend, a family member, a teacher, etc. Write an encouraging note, make cookies for a neighbor, do something nice you don’t normally do. Have fun!!

Comments: Write a comment that includes what you did, the first name of who you did it for, what that person’s reaction was, and how this act of kindness affected you. Write 4-6 sentences and use correct spelling (no text  talk).

Reply: Reply to three other people. Read their comments and make a reply that gives them feedback. You can ask them a question, you can tell them how much you liked their idea (be specific), but you must write at least 3 sentences and you must use correct spelling (again no text talk.)

In light of September 11th, please read the following quotes about the events that took place 12 years ago. In your response be sure to include:
1. an analysis of the quotes (what do they mean?)
2. what they mean to you
3. how they relate to the theme of our unit, "What Do You Stand For?"
4. Include your first name ONLY!

--Ms. Brummer

“The attacks of September 11th were intended to break our spirit. Instead we have emerged stronger and more unified. We feel renewed devotion to the principles of political, economic, and religious freedom, the rule of law and respect for human life. We are more determined than ever to live our lives in freedom." 
- Rudolph Giuliani, former mayor of New York City

"Our enemies have made the mistake that America’s enemies always make. They saw liberty and thought they saw weakness. And now, they see defeat."
- George W. Bush, former President of the United States
